I've been coming here for probably the last two years on and off. It's a nice medium sized cafe that's run by what it appears to be Persian brothers. The scene is filled with hip young 20 year olds with their MacBooks trying to get some work done while getting their caffeine fix. the drinks here are fairly good however slightly on the higher end of the price tag. Free wifi however it's been a hit or miss at times. They also have one of those stamp cards after 8 drinks I believe however I don't believe a lot of people use them. The seating can be pretty packed sometimes but you should be able to grab a seat most of the time. Overall nice place to come and swing by for some quick work to get done on queen street west.
